Augmented Reality Glasses

Augmented Reality (AR) technology has come a long way and is now ready for its next phase with the development of AR glasses. Companies like Vuzix and Lumus are taking the lead in advancing waveguide technology to bring AR glasses to the market. These glasses will allow users to stay connected with the online world without losing touch with reality.

The Vuzix Ultralite is a prime example of this technology, offering a super-slim and lightweight design that will be available soon. The glasses pair with a user’s smartphone and provide notifications, directions, and more through a bright and crisp green display. This design is set to change the way we experience AR technology, as it moves beyond just a smartphone screen.

In the future, AR glasses are expected to become even more advanced, and Lumus is already working on prototypes for its Z-Lens technology that promises a full-colour display in lightweight AR glasses. Although the finished product is still a few years away, the demonstration of the Z-Lens technology at CES 2023 has set the stage for what’s to come.

Wearable VR Gloves

One of the VR accessories that caught the attention of visitors at CES 2023 was the ContactGlove by DiverX. This Japanese company has been making strides in the VR technology space and their latest offering, the ContactGlove gloves, are a testament to their innovative spirit. These gloves offer a unique advantage over traditional VR gloves, which are limited to working with hand-tracking applications or ones built specifically for gloves. The ContactGlove gloves, on the other hand, have the capability of replacing SteamVR controllers.

This means that instead of using physical controllers, players can control VR experiences with hand gestures. While this feature may not be the most intuitive, it could be a game-changer for some players who prefer a more natural and immersive control system. VR in the Car

Holoride, an Audi-backed startup, unveiled its in-vehicle virtual reality entertainment system at CES 2023 in Las Vegas. The company launched a retrofit device that can be installed in any vehicle, allowing it to be VR-ready. The retrofit pack, weighing less than a half a pound, can be mounted via a suction cup on the vehicle’s windshield and supports up to two connected headsets. The package includes the retrofit hardware, a HTC VIVE Flow headset, a one-year subscription to the Holoride platform, and a safety strap, and is priced at $799. The retrofit device is also available as a standalone purchase for $199. The widespread adoption of in-car VR technology by consumers will greatly expand Holoride’s market reach.

Holoride’s in-car VR technology aims to enhance the in-vehicle experience by offering passengers an immersive entertainment experience while they travel. The technology creates a virtual world that moves in sync with the motion of the vehicle, allowing passengers to be transported to new and exciting environments, making their travel time more enjoyable and less boring. The Pimax Crystal

The Pimax Crystal, an upcoming, premium VR headset, is poised to be the future of virtual reality technology. Priced at a staggering $1,900, this headset combines the best features of Pimax’s previous models, the 5K Super and 8K, and takes VR to the next level. The Pimax 5K Super has been praised for its ultra-fast refresh rate and wide field of view, while the 8K boasts of its 4K resolution for each eye. With the Pimax Crystal, users now have the ability to choose between refresh rate and field of view, offering them the ultimate virtual reality experience.

At its highest refresh rate of 180Hz, the Pimax Crystal offers a reduced field of view of 150 degrees, making it perfect for fast-paced, action-packed VR games. For those who want to immerse themselves in the virtual world with a wider field of view, the refresh rate drops to 120Hz.
